Detailed Description
The present invention will be described in detail below with reference to the accompanying drawings and specific embodiments.
Please refer to fig. 1 and fig. 2, the utility model provides a cell-phone with K sings function, including cell-phone body 1 locate cell-phone body 1 in the audio mixing PCB board 12, locate respectively 1 upper portion of cell-phone body and lower part and respectively with two loudspeaker 13 and a receiver 14 that audio mixing PCB board 12 electricity is connected, correspond on the audio mixing PCB board 12 two loudspeaker 13 are equipped with two audio amplifier respectively, each audio amplifier all is equipped with multimedia input interface and receiver input interface, multimedia input interface with cell-phone body 1's multimedia output electric connection, receiver input interface with receiver electric connection. Specifically, the sound mixing PCB 12 is further provided with a filter circuit connected between the input interfaces of the two receivers and the receivers, and the filter circuit filters the audio frequency transmitted through the receivers 14, so as to filter other noises except the human voice, thereby improving the definition of the output audio frequency, and improving the experience of singing the song. The filter circuit is implemented by adopting the circuit design in the prior art, and the filter circuit which can realize the function is suitable for the embodiment. Preferably, after the two speakers 13 are mounted on the mobile phone body 1, a steel wire mesh enclosure 15 is sleeved outside the two speakers 13, so as to play a role in dust prevention and protection.
Referring to fig. 5, each of the audio amplifiers includes: the single-pole double-throw microphone comprises a first multimedia input interface, a second multimedia input interface, a power amplification unit, a single-pole double-throw switch and a receiver input interface, wherein the single-pole double-throw switch is provided with a first input end, a second input end and an output end, the first multimedia input interface is connected with one input end of the power amplification unit, the second multimedia input interface is connected with the first input end of the single-pole double-throw switch, the second input end of the single-pole double-throw switch is connected with the receiver input interface, the output end of the single-pole double-throw switch is connected with the other input end of the power amplification unit, and the output end of the power amplification unit is connected with a loudspeaker. The first multimedia input interface and the second multimedia input interface of one of the two audio amplifiers are connected with the left sound channel output end in the multimedia output end of the mobile phone body, and the first multimedia input interface and the second multimedia input interface of the other audio amplifier are connected with the right sound channel output end in the multimedia output end of the mobile phone body. The inconsistency of impedance of a sound source merging circuit and a sound source differential circuit is solved by designing a single-pole double-throw switch to switch the input sound source, so that the effect of natural sound mixing of multimedia audio and receiver audio is realized. Specifically, the input end of the single-pole double-throw switch is connected to the second multimedia input end and the receiver input end of an audio amplifier, the mobile phone body is disconnected from the receiver input end and connected with the second multimedia input end under the condition of only playing multimedia, the audio of the second multimedia input end and the audio of the first multimedia input end are amplified together through the power amplification unit and then played through a loudspeaker, it is worth mentioning that because the first multimedia input interface and the second multimedia interface in one audio amplifier are connected with the left channel of the multimedia output end of the mobile phone body, and the first multimedia input interface and the second multimedia interface in the other audio amplifier are connected with the right channel of the multimedia output end of the mobile phone body, when the mobile phone body plays multimedia audio, the two loudspeakers respectively play the audio of the left and right sound channels, so that the stereo surround effect is improved. When audio is input through the input end of the telephone receiver, the single-pole double-throw switch is disconnected from the second multimedia input end and connected to the input end of the telephone receiver, and the audio at the input end of the telephone receiver and the audio at the first multimedia input end are amplified through the power amplification unit and then are played through the loudspeaker, so that audio mixing of the multimedia audio and the audio of the telephone receiver is realized. Meanwhile, the receiver is also connected to the input end of the power amplification unit of the other audio amplifier through the single-pole double-throw switch of the other audio amplifier, the audio of the receiver is amplified through the two audio amplification units and then is played through the two loudspeakers, the audio mixing effect is achieved with the multimedia audio of the two first multimedia input ends, during audio mixing, the two audio amplifiers are respectively connected with the left and right sound channels of the multimedia output end of the mobile phone body, the receiver audio is also amplified through the two audio amplifiers and then is played, surround stereo sound is strong, and the K song experience of a K singer is greatly increased. The single-pole double-throw switch adopts the prior art to realize the control and the installation, and the single-pole double-throw switch which can achieve the effect is suitable for the embodiment. In this embodiment, the power amplification units of the one audio amplifier and the other audio amplifier may both adopt a power amplification chip with a model number FT2820 or a power amplification chip with a model number AW8733 ATQR. As shown in fig. 4, the power amplification unit of the audio amplifier adopts a power amplifier chip U904 with a model number FT2820, wherein a line 103 is a first multimedia input interface, a line 102 is a second multimedia input interface, and a line 101 is a receiver input interface; as shown in fig. 3, the power amplification unit of the another audio amplifier adopts a power amplifier chip U301 with model AW8733ATQR, the line 104 is a first multimedia input interface, the line 105 is a second multimedia input interface, and the line 106 is a receiver input interface. The power amplifier chips of the two power amplifying units can adopt any one of the two power amplifier chips or the two power amplifier chips for mixed use, and the technical effects can be realized.
The mobile phone body 1 comprises a processor, a display driving unit connected with the processor, a display unit 20 connected with the display driving unit, a storage unit connected with the processor and a key unit 21 connected with the processor, wherein the display unit is used for displaying an operation interface, the key unit is convenient for a user to perform key operation, and the storage unit can be used for storing multimedia audio, such as accompaniment. In this embodiment, the processor of the mobile phone body 1 is an MTK6261D processor disposed on the PCB. Preferably, the mobile phone body 1 is further provided with a USB interface 16 and a USB soft rubber plug 17 for protecting the USB interface 16, multimedia audio can be downloaded through a network, and stored in the mobile phone body 1 through the USB interface 16, and data in the mobile phone body 1 can also be exported through the USB interface 16, one end of the soft rubber plug 17 is connected to the mobile phone body 1, and the other end of the soft rubber plug is fixed in the USB interface 16 in a pluggable manner, so as to protect the USB interface 16. The top of the mobile phone body 1 is further provided with a flashlight lamp 18, the side of the mobile phone body 1 is further provided with a push-pull switch 19 corresponding to the flashlight lamp 18, the flashlight lamp 18 is controlled to be turned on and off, specifically, the push-pull switch 19 is connected with an internal conducting piece, and therefore the purpose that the flashlight 18 is turned on when a circuit is conducted and the flashlight 18 is turned off when the circuit is disconnected is achieved. The switch-controlled flashlight can be switched on and off without opening a mobile phone screen, is convenient to use, and is more convenient for the old to use and operate.
